test_wd_reuse.c - Test watch descriptor reuse
The test program demonstrates that inotify_add_watch may return a watch
descriptor ID for which events still exist on the inotify queue.
It creates one watch for file "0" to demonstrate the problem.
Afterwards it creates and removes watches again and again just to force
idr_alloc_cyclic to reach INT_MAX.
Then events are created for file "0" on the queue.
The watch for "0" is removed.
A watch for another file is created.
Example program output (after a few hours, on Linux 3.14.4 x86_64):
...
2147459044 2147467235 2147475426 2147483617 2147483647
Preparation done
BINGO Collision detected
Watch descriptor 1 for /tmp/test/8192
Watch descriptor 1 for /tmp/test/0
